G-Quadruplex-Protein Interactome at Human Gene Promoters

2025-01-02

Abstract excerpt

DNA-protein interactions at gene promoters play a critical role in gene expression. The promoters of human cells are highly enriched in guanine-rich sequences, which can form four-stranded G-quadruplex (G4) structures. G4s are emerging as a distinct class of structure-based regulatory elements in gene regulation, and their interaction with proteins is essential for the role G4s play.
